Global Trace Element Fertilizers Market size was valued at USD 933.5 Million in 2024 and is poised to grow from USD 996.04 Million in 2025 to USD 1673.38 Million by 2033, growing at a CAGR of 6.7% during the forecast period (2026-2033).
The global trace element fertilizers market is primarily driven by the ongoing necessity to address micronutrient deficiencies that adversely impact crop productivity and food quality. These fertilizers replenish essential elements such as zinc, boron, manganese, and copper, which are often depleted by intensive NPK-centric agricultural practices. The market has evolved significantly, moving from basic soil applications to sophisticated chelated formulations and foliar sprays, reflecting advancements in agronomic research and changing economic landscapes. Increased awareness among farmers and the effectiveness of diagnostic testing have accelerated demand for targeted trace element products, fostering innovation in chelation and controlled-release formulations. Additionally, climate change and soil degradation heighten the reliance on precision application services and initiatives such as biofortification, further expanding market opportunities and adoption in diverse crops.

Driver of the Global Trace Element Fertilizers Market
The growing emphasis on balanced plant nutrition has led to a heightened demand for trace element fertilizers, as farmers aim to address micronutrient deficiencies that can negatively impact crop quality and resilience. By effectively targeting specific nutrient gaps, these fertilizers contribute to enhanced plant health, promote more reliable yields, and minimize the need for corrective interventions later in the growing season. Additionally, the interest from agronomists and various players in the supply chain to optimize nutrient profiles encourages farmers to incorporate trace element inputs into their nutrient management strategies, thereby supporting sustained growth in the market and fostering wider acceptance among agricultural stakeholders.
Restraints in the Global Trace Element Fertilizers Market
The Global Trace Element Fertilizers market faces significant challenges due to the high costs of production, formulation, and specialized raw materials. These elevated expenses can deter cost-sensitive growers from adopting trace element fertilizers, as they often opt for traditional nutrient sources that are more familiar and economically viable. Such resistance among agricultural producers can hinder the overall market growth, as they may delay their adoption until clear and substantial agronomic benefits are evident. Consequently, suppliers experience increased pressure on pricing and profit margins, which can impede investment and innovation within the sector, slowing the progress of the market.
Market Trends of the Global Trace Element Fertilizers Market
The Global Trace Element Fertilizers market is witnessing a significant shift towards precision agriculture, characterized by the integration of advanced technologies that enable targeted nutrient management. Farmers are increasingly utilizing soil sensors, variable-rate application technologies, and data analytics to optimize the use of micronutrients, ensuring precise placement tailored to specific crop needs. This trend prompts suppliers to innovate by creating formulations that align with these technologies, while also offering comprehensive services that integrate with digital farming platforms. As a result, this market evolution emphasizes the efficiency of inputs, minimizes waste, and promotes sustainable practices, fostering stronger collaborations between agricultural producers and technology providers.
